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 17 -- United States Patent no. 12,314,674, issued on May 27, was assigned to Salesforce Inc. (San Francisco).

"Applied artificial intelligence technology for narrative generation based on a conditional outcome framework" was invented by Andrew R. Paley (Chicago), Nathan D. Nichols (Chicago), Matthew L. Trahan (Chicago), Maia Lewis Meza (Chicago), Michael Tien Thinh Pham (Chicago) and Charlie M. Truong (Aurora, Ill.).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"Artificial intelligence (AI) technology can be used in combination with composable communication goal statements to facilitate a user's ability to quickly structure story outlines in a manner usable by an NLG narrative generation...
